Your yearly chance of being a victim of drug-related crime in Baggs is about 1 in 139.
Drug-Related Crime costs the average Baggs resident about $53 per year.
Crime Grade's drug-related crime map shows the safest places in Baggs in green. The most dangerous areas in Baggs are in red, with moderately safe areas in yellow. Crime rates on the map are weighted by the type and severity of the crime.
The D- grade means the rate of drug-related crime is much higher than the average US city. Baggs is in the 10th percentile for safety, meaning 90% of cities are safer and 10% of cities are more dangerous. This analysis applies to Baggs's proper boundaries only. See the table on nearby places below for nearby cities.
The rate of drug-related crime in Baggs is 7.199 per 1,000 residents during a standard year. People who live in Baggs generally consider the southwest part of the city to be the safest.
Your chance of being a victim of drug-related crime in Baggs may be as high as 1 in 139 in the south neighborhoods, or as low as 1 in 149 in the southwest part of the city.
By a simple count ignoring population, more drug-related crime occurs in the southeast parts of Baggs, WY: about 1 per year. The west part of Baggs has fewer cases of drug-related crime with only 0 in a typical year.
The chart below compares the drug-related crime rate in Baggs to the Wyoming state average and the national average. All rates are the number of crimes per 1,000 residents in a standard year.
| Baggs, WY: | 7.199 |
|---|---|
| Wyoming: | 5.802 |
| USA: | 3.112 |
Considering only the drug-related crime rate, Baggs is less safe than the Wyoming state average and less safe than the national average.
